Corgi 1138

Corgi 1138 Ford Articulated Transporter "CORGI CARS". Near mint plus/boxed (wear), with 2 packing pieces. From The Reference Collection.

Notes

A fresh and shining example of this popular Corgi model made between 1966-69.

C1138p3511

C1138p3512

Complete with both wing mirrors (including the reflective pieces), ladders at the side of the cab and roof horns (a little tarnished now). Bright silver side panels with Corgi dog logo on both sides. Yellow and black labels at rear are fresh and bright.
A few marks to the paint finish.
The *card stand
on which the transporter sits, is complete and very bright with notably tear-free wheel slots. A little ‘depression’ caused by the weight of the model and note that it lacks one of the side pull-tabs.

C1138p3513

Plenty of information on the box reverse.
Unusually, this item comes complete with both card inner packing pieces.

C1138p3514

The pictorial end flap box is complete and has vivid colours. Some handling wear /foxing to the card and a couple of repaired tears.
